Letha Lucille Cearley was called home to be with the Lord on Sunday, February 22, 2015.

Lucille was born July 13, 1933 in Bristow, Oklahoma. She married the love of her life Gene on October 1, 1950 in Huntsville, Arkansas. She resided in Owasso, Oklahoma with her husband Gene until moving to Gila, NM in August of 2014. Lucille had a tender and giving spirit and loved her large family and family gatherings. She enjoyed singing and playing the piano and being involved in the church. She was self taught in playing the piano, bass fiddle and accordion, and played in church.

She is survived by her husband of 64 years, Eugene "Gene" Cearley; her children Ron (Vee) Cearley of Kellyville, OK; Dan (Carolyn) Cearley of Gila; Connie Denise (Speedy) Gonzales also of Gila, NM; brothers, Elzy Gower of Sapulpa, OK and Lonnie Gower of Bristow, OK; sisters, Elvis (Richard) Goodman of Sapulpa, OK, Ruth Rebstock of Sapulpa and June (Tommy) Ashley of Farmington, NM; thirteen grandchildren; twenty-five great-grandchildren and four great-great grandchildren.

She was preceded in death by her sister Nora Saiz, her parents, Lillian and Alvin Gower and granddaughter Misty Jean Gonzales.

A Memorial Service will be celebrated Wednesday, February 25, at 2pm at Gila Valley Baptist Church with Pastor Tar Henderson officiating. Cremation will take place at Terrazas Crematory.
